Urban Food Fest is an innovative and contemporary street food market and events company based in central London.

Urban Food Fest is at the forefront of the latest trends in design food and experiences.

The team is comprised of passionate, dedicated and like-minded individuals who are encouraged to be open-minded and bring new ideas to the business.

Founded in 2013, the company create bespoke street food markets and events for brands including Apple, Manchester United, Nike, De Beers, Warner Bros, Sony, e Bay, Unilever, Adidas, Lexus, Peroni, Volkswagen, UBS, GAP and Superdry.

The role We are looking for an events administrator who is dynamic, committed and motivated for a full-time role.

The role involves liaising with suppliers, clients, event management, building relationships, assisting with our markets and private events for international brands and large corporate clients.
